ABSTRACT
Environmental information disclosure is important in implementing enterprise’s environmental
responsibility, which helps to achieve the carbon peaking and carbon neutrality goal. This paper
examines the effect of entrepreneur heterogeneity on environmental information disclosure based on
a large sample of Chinese listed companies in new energy industry over the 2008-2020 period. We found
that entrepreneur heterogeneity can significantly affect environmental information disclosure. Moreover,
environmental management practice can also promote corporate environmental information disclosure
and it works as the mediator between entrepreneur heterogeneity and environmental information
disclosure. Further, through multi-cluster analysis, we found that environmental information disclosure
varies among firms with different characteristics. Our results highlight the importance of environmental
disclosure in corporate strategic decisions and deliver multidimensional implications.
